For three dollars (in 2024 on steam) you get a fairly well put together and somewhat arcadey "roguelite". Its fun and simple and when youre going for a high score pretty intense. Even at the price though its just not enough. I cant see myself coming back to it often if ever. Its just very simple after an hour or two of playing and you'd already seen all there is too see at the half hour mark.
This is an amazing homage to early Survival Horror games without any of the archaic sometimes frustrating clunk. Its got an intriguing story, eccentric characters that feel alive, a theme park to explore that is oozing with charm and gameplay that is smooth and fun.
Its also got bonus content to unlock, satisfying to find secrets and clever puzzles that make you feel smart solving them. This is really my favorite game i've played this year and is something any fan of the genre should probably pick up. I can see myself someday soon going back for the two achievements i missed

This is a fantastic sequel to 2033. It's thrilling story keep you hooked. Satisfying gunplay, immersive elements like wiping off your visor or charging your lights. If played on Ranger the hud disappearing and being elements on your person is nice (though I would have liked to be able to check my ammo stocks outside of shops.) Overall I highly recommend this game. Still haven't played the DLC but looking forward to it.
